What to do if you found a dog in West Jordan, state of Utah

If you encounter a stray dog in West Jordan, it’s essential to act thoughtfully and responsibly. Here are some steps you can take:

  • Approach the dog slowly and cautiously.
  • Check for identification tags or a microchip.
  • Contact local animal shelters or animal control to report the found dog.
  • Post on local community social media groups to alert others.
  • Consider taking the dog to a vet for a microchip scan.
  • Provide food and water if you can safely contain the pet.

By following these steps, you can help reunite the lost dog with its owner and ensure its safety until a more permanent solution is found.

Additionally, if your own dog goes missing, it’s crucial to act quickly. Start by searching your neighborhood and asking neighbors if they have seen your pet. Utilize social media platforms to spread the word; many pets have been reunited this way. Make sure to contact local shelters and provide them with a detailed description of your dog, along with your contact information.

It’s also important to keep your pet's information updated. Microchipping your dog can significantly improve the chances of being reunited if they ever get lost.

How to write an ad about a dog found in West Jordan, state of Utah

Creating an effective ad for a found dog is vital to increasing the chances of finding its owner. Here are some tips on what to include:

  • Include a clear description of the dog, such as size, color, and any distinctive features.
  • Add where and when you found the dog.
  • Provide your contact information and encourage owners to reach out.
  • Consider offering a photo of the dog; a visual can make your ad more effective.
  • Post the ad in public places such as community boards, parks, and veterinary offices.
  • Utilize social media platforms to broaden the reach of your ad.

By following these guidelines, you can effectively communicate with the community and increase the chances of reuniting a lost dog with its owner.
